Transaction db72cfbf2b40d24a06bc9a126e006be5ecdd8ff9e040721d8441c8959e715b0f
1 Input
1 Output
-
db72cfbf2b40d24a06bc9a126e006be5ecdd8ff9e040721d8441c8959e715b0f:0
- value
- 18625034
- script pubkey
- OP_0 OP_PUSHBYTES_20 38c8ff7fd811aa827f43c8c73d7a1ee66fc1c17d
- address
- bc1q8ry07l7czx4gyl6rerrn67s7uehurstay72eax